![]() I just got back from taking my family to the Alabaster Caverns State Park. If your ever in this part of the country, it's worth it to go. Heck, if you've never been to a cave system before, you should go when you get the chance. It's like a whole other world, and NOTHING like the movies.....
I've never been inside a cave like this before, so it was pretty amazing to me. I learned quite a lot, actually! There are 44,000 bats that live in these caves, and several species. The males actually don't hang upside down with the group, but choose to stay in pairs in random areas. There were raccoon tracks all the way into the middle of the cave, which shocked me - it's plenty dark in there! Cool thing is, they allow "Wild Caving", which is exploring caves that aren't part of the tour. I actually thought about going there to apply for a summer job, but I'm not to fond of poisonous snakes, and they have 3 different types of rattlesnakes in that area, so yeah.....
